Size and weight are big decision factors when you are trying to find the ideal camera for your needs.
In this section, we are going to illustrate the Canon 170 IS and Canon ELPH 130 side-by-side from the front, back and top in their relative dimensions. Canon 170 IS has external dimensions of 100 x 58 x 23 mm (3.94 x 2.28 x 0.91″) and weighs 141 g (0.31 lb / 4.97 oz) (including batteries). Canon ELPH 130 has external dimensions of 95 x 56 x 21 mm (3.74 x 2.2 x 0.83″) and weighs 133 g (0.29 lb / 4.69 oz) (including batteries).
Below you can see the front-view size comparison of the Canon 170 IS and the Canon ELPH 130. Canon ELPH 130 is clearly the smaller of the two cameras. Its body is 5mm narrower, 2mm shorter and 2mm thinner than Canon 170 IS.

Weight is another important factor, especially when deciding on a camera that you want to carry with you all day.
Canon ELPH 130 is 8g lighter than the Canon 170 IS but we don't think this will make a significant difference.
Weather Sealing
Unfortunately neither the Canon PowerShot ELPH 170 IS (IXUS 170) nor Canon ELPH 130 (IXUS 140) provides any type of weather sealing in their bodies, so you have to give extra care especially when you are shooting outdoors. LCD Screen Size and Features
Canon ELPH 130's 3.00" LCD screen is slightly larger than Canon 170 IS's 2.7 screen.
Unfortunately, both cameras has fixed screens so they don't tilt or flip in directions.
